Ingredients

  • 3/4 cup + 1 tablespoon (180 grams) sugar
  • 3 cups (400 grams) all-purpose flour
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 7 ounces (200 grams) cold butter, cubed, plus extra for greasing the pan
  • 1/2 cup (65 grams) toasted, salted pepitas (or pecans)
  • 3/4 cup (a little less than 1 ounce) Jamaica Flowers OR 2 tablespoons of ground hibiscus (I like Burlap & Barrel's Desert Hibiscus)
  • 1/2 cup (110 grams) sugar
  • 3 tablespoons (33 grams) cornstarch
  • 1 tablespoon finely grated fresh ginger
  • 1/2 teaspoon (1.5 grams) ground allspice
  • 1/2 teaspoon (1.5 grams) black pepper
  • 5 cups (650 grams or about 1 1/2 pounds before trimming) rhubarb, cut into ½-inch pieces
  • A cup of Mexican crema, sour cream or creme fraiche
